Protect Yourself With Critical Illness Insurance


Critical illness insurance in today's world is very necessary. People who are surviving from major health concerns, in that same process need funds for recovery. With that, lets discuss how a Michigan critical illness policy works.

The critical illness policy that we offer gives a Michigan consumer protection in regards to heart attacks, life threatening cancer, kidney failure, strokes, and organ transfers.

By reading this posting, you should understand my point. Consumers are surviving from heart attacks, cancer, strokes, kidney failures, and even organs transfers. So how does a critical illness policy work?

The consumer picks and benefit ($10,000 - $100,000) and if he/she suffers one of the five illnesses that I have named, then the benefit is paid out. You also receive 25% of your benefit if you need angioplasty or artery bypass. It is that simple in a nutshell. That payment can be used to pay off your health insurance deductible, traveling bills, etc.

When it comes to pricing, it is beyond affordable.

Age 35 male, $10,000 benefit, non tobacco $15.42 $25,000 benefit, $31.88

Age 35 female, $10,000 benefit, non tobacco $11.59 $25,000 benefit, $22.23

Age 50 male, $10,000 benefit, non tobacco $34.32 $25,000 benefit, $79.04

Age 50 female, $10,000 benefit, non tobacco $24.02 $25,000 benefit, $53.30

The one question I get with regards to our critical illness is what happens if I die without using the policy? I pay and what do I get? With our policy, if you pass without using your policy, your beneficiary will receive all the premium you have put in. Your money does not go to waste.

Another perk with this policy, is if we combine it (husband + wife), the premiums actually become cheaper.

This policy is underwritten, so be prepared to answer health related questions.
